On 12/08/18 04:31 AM, Matthew Wilcox wrote:
> I pondered asking Logan to change his parser to include the bus number
> as a solution, but then I remembered the entire point of this is to make
> specifying a device robust against bus number assignmnet changes.  I suppose
> we could have the parser accept and ignore the bus number ...

Yes, exactly. Bjorn's already accepted the series but we could add
support for ignored bus letters in another patch if we want. I just
think that might be confusing when you end up in a situation where the
path includes numbers that no longer actually match the actual addresses
after the bus numbers change.
